The first step in restoring vision is to remove the cloudy lens surgically. This is one of the safest, most successful, and widely performed operations. Of the 400,000 to 600,000 cases performed annually in this country, over 90 percent succeed in helping to restore vision, thanks to improvements in surgical techniques and in the skills of ophthalmic surgeons. Contact lenses are, in most cases, a far better solution once the aphake is convinced that the “newfangled” device is worth trying. Advantages are the normal appearance of the eye and crisp visual acuity. Since only 6 percent magnification of objects occurs, the images appear to be of normal size, fusion can take place, and excellent peripheral vision and depth perception will result.
